Mr. Yadong WANG is a Senior Partner at Zhonglun W&D Law Firm. In 1992, he joined Jun He LLP and served as a partner for ten years, and later, as one of the core members, co‑founded two boutique law firms focusing on cross‑border matters, including Run Ming Law Office. In 2016, Mr. Wang, together with key members of his team, joined Rui Bai Law Firm — a member firm of the PwC global network — as a partner and director. In 2020, he joined Shanghai Lang Yue (Beijing) Law Firm, the joint operation office established in the Shanghai Pilot Free Trade Zone between Lang Yue and the leading international law firm Allen & Overy, and served as Senior Counsel.


Mr. Wang has long focused on cross-border dispute resolution, intellectual property and corporate law, providing legal services to numerous multinational companies including various major Japanese enterprises, and has handled a large number of landmark cases of significant industry influence. Mr. Wang was recommended for seven consecutive years by Chambers & Partners in cross-border dispute resolution and intellectual property, was named one of the top 25 “Popular Lawyers” in China by ALB, and was shortlisted as one of five nominees for ALB’s “Managing Partner of the Year” award. Mr. Wang has also been recognised as one of the “Top Ten Counsels in Beijing” and named “Beijing Leading Lawyer”.

Intellectual Property (all IP cases below represented by Mr. Wang received extensive media coverage):

  • Acted as one of the counsels representing Ms. Shuxian Li, the partner of the last Chinese emperor Aisin-Gioro Puyi, in the copyright dispute over Puyi’s biography FROM EMPEROR TO CITIZEN. This case is generally regarded as the most influential intellectual property case in China, ultimately obtaining a favourable judgment.
  • Represented General Motors Daewoo Automobile and Technology Company (GM DAEWOO) Co., Ltd. in a copyright infringement and unfair competition dispute against Chery Automobile Co., Ltd.. The case was named as one of the “Top Ten Influential Litigations in China” that year.
  • Acted as one of the counsels for Ericsson (China) Co., Ltd. (ERICSSON) in two patent infringements, which concluded with a favourable outcome for Ericsson and were named “Deal of the Year” by China Business Law Journal.
  • Successfully represented Yamaha Motor Co., Ltd. (YAMAHA) in the trademark infringement case, delivering a complete victory and earning the recognition of a well-known trademark for Yamaha. The Supreme People’s Court of China published it in the Gazette of the Supreme People’s Court as a typical case.
  • Acted for Walmart Stores in trademark infringement and unfair competition proceedings, securing a win for the client and well‑known trademark recognition for “Wal‑Mart”. The case was named one of the “Top Ten Well‑known Trademark Recognition Cases in China”.
  • Represented Louis Vuitton, Burberry, Chanel, Prada and Gucci — five well-known brand owners — to a successful outcome in a trademark infringement litigation against Beijing’s Silk Street Market. The matter topped the “Top Ten Intellectual Property Cases in 2006” list published by the Beijing High People’s Court. (Mr. Wang was the lead litigation counsel jointly appointed by the five brand owners.)
  • Represented Johnson & Johnson’s subsidiary, Beijing Dabao Cosmetics Co., Ltd., in three IP cases involving unfair competition and trademark infringement, one of which cases was ranked first among the “50 Typical Intellectual Property Cases in 2013” released by the Chinese courts.
